What if streetcars were as good as subways? Take a look at this trip in Budapest. The tram - the longest in the world at 56m (183 ft) comes every 2 minutes, and takes one minute less than the subway even though the origin and destination are the same. @ttcriders.bsky.social #topoli #onpoli

In 1967, Sweden changed the direction of traffic from left (like in the UK) to right (like in Continental Europe). To this day, I am fascinated by the fact that commuters at Stockholm Central Station are still walking on the left.

On this Kraków street, the tram in the opposite direction circulates in mixed traffic, against the curb. On the right, the centre lane is reserved for streetcars. The general traffic lane is elevated to the level of the sidewalk to slow down cars and provide level boarding. @ttcriders.bsky.social
